摘要:

以内蒙古大兴安岭兴安落叶松林火烧迹地为研究对象,采用分层取样的方法对群落中植被进行了调查,分析比较了不同火烧木管理方式下兴安落叶松林林下群落恢复过程中物种组成、多样性指数及地上生物量的差异。结果表明:火烧木择伐方式下火烧迹地与未火烧对照样地林下群落相似性最大。不同火烧木管理方式下,火烧迹地林下群落多个α多样性指数均表现为草本层>灌木层的趋势。不同火烧木管理样地草本层Simpson和Shannon-Wiener指数均小于对照样地,而在灌木层都大于对照样地。3种不同类型火烧木管理方式火烧迹地恢复13年后,林下草本层生物量均小于对照样地,而灌木层生物量较对照样地相比都有不同程度的增加。

关键词: 兴安落叶松林, 火烧迹地, 火烧木管理, 物种多样性, 地上生物量

Abstract:

In this study,Larix gmelinii forest burned areas were observed under different firewood management modes.The natural regeneration conditions,species composition,aboveground biomass,community biodiversity were researched in 2016.The results showed that the similarity of understory community under the burntwood selective cutting mode compared with unburned area showed the highest.The alpha diversity index of community at each layer under different burntwood management modes showed a ranking of herb layer > shrub layer.The simpson and shannon-wiener indexes in herb shrub layers were increased compared with unburned area,while the two indices are larger than the unburned area in the shrub layer.After thirteen years,the understory herb layer biomass was less than that of the control plot,while the shrub layer biomass increased to varying degrees compared to the control plot.

Key words: Larix gmelini forest, burned area, burntwood management, diversity of species, aboveground biomass
